Recent research reveals alarming environmental impacts of a battery fire at an energy facility in California. Scientists discovered high concentrations of heavy metal nanoparticles, including nickel, manganese, and cobalt, in nearby marsh soil. This lithium-ion battery contamination raises concerns about ecological effects on aquatic life and ecosystems.

In addition, important battery fire characteristics involved in various EV fire scenarios, obtained through testing, are analysed. The tested peak heat release rate (PHHR in kW) varies with the energy capacity of LIBs (EB in Wh) crossing different scales as PHRR=2EB0.6.
Additionally, there are no doubt potential fire risks during the collection, recycling, treatment and disposal of batteries and EVs. This risk is linked to the SOC and capacity of the considered LIB. Cumulated battery bulks and EVs have a lower self-ignition temperature or a higher self-ignition risk.
